Pope Francis Makes Unscheduled Visit to Little Sisters of the Poor

On day two of his trip to Washington, Pope Francis made an unscheduled surprise visit to the Little Sisters of the Poor following his canonization Mass. The sisters have a convent in the city. The pontiff made the visit to show support for the sisters, who are suing the federal government over the contraception mandate in the Affordable Care Act.

The Little Sisters of the Poor is a religious order that was founded to serve the elderly poor. As the Little Sisters do not exclusively employ or serve Catholics, (which would violate their vow of hospitality) they are not considered to be a "religious employer" and are subjected to the HHS Contraception Mandate. The sisters filed suit in September 2013.

Pope Francis made special mention of the need to preserve religious liberty during his remarks this morning outside the White House. While he didn't name the Little Sisters explicitly, it was fairly obvious what he was talking about.
